Export of a Batch of Hopper Cars to Kazakhstan
08.09.2023
The Uzbekistan Foundry and Mechanical Plant (LFM), which is part of the national railway company “Uzbekiston temir yo’llari,” has announced the shipment of a batch of railway wagons to Kazakhstan. The exact quantity of wagons has not been disclosed, as reported by the railway portal Railway Supply.
These wagons were purchased by the freight carrier “Shyngar Trans,” which serves as the official forwarder for the Kazakh national railway holding, “Kazakhstan Temir Zholy.”

The technical specifications of the supplied hopper cars include a payload capacity of 72.5 tons and a volume of 61.6 m³. These specifications correspond to the model 19-9596 hopper-cement car, production of which began at LFM in 2017.
It is worth noting that in 2022, LFM did not produce cement cars; instead, the plant’s primary production consisted of grain hopper cars of the 19-9600-01 model.
